Law on the basic provisions of mining (Law 11/67). Résumé According to this Law the mineral resources of Indonesia are divided in strategic, vital or other and the exploration and exploitation of them is conceded to State, Regional or private enterprises or on a family basis if the mining area is a small one. Mining authorization shall be accordingly granted to the bodies in charge of operations by the competent authorities and shall include:general survey of the mining site,exploration, exploitation,processing and refining, transportation and ultimately sales. Compensation damages shall be paid to the landowner in case of accident or collateral damage. Royalties and levvies must be paid off for the mining operations to the State Authority.
